Merseyside STEM Ambassador Extension Training: Don’t miss out!
MerseySTEM are pleased to announce that we will be running a STEM Ambassador Extension Training session on Wednesday 2nd March, 2016, 2pm – 4pm, at Hope University, Hope Park Campus, Taggart Avenue, Childwall, L19 9JD.
This training session, open to all STEM Ambassadors, whether new to the scheme or well-experienced, forms part of STEMNET’s programme of building a nationwide support offer for STEM Ambassadors, giving them the skills and confidence to deliver enriching and exciting STEM activities to young people in the UK.
The training in STEM communication and engagement, focuses on providing STEM Ambassadors with skills they can apply across the spectrum of STEM Ambassador activities.
The STEM Ambassador Extension Training aims to help ambassadors to:
– Identify the attributes of successful STEM Ambassador activities
– Recognise the importance of delivery style when carrying out successful STEM Ambassador activities
– Formulate an idea for a new STEM Ambassador activity
It looks at ideas such as:
– What is learning?
– Personal learning and thinking skills (an idea common in current educational practice in schools)
– Presentation skills (Jargon-busting, vocal inflection, body language etc)
– Formulas for developing successful activities
